Understanding Cold Laser Therapy
Cold laser therapy, also known as low-level laser therapy (LLLT), is a cutting-edge strategy to hair repair that takes advantage of specific wavelengths of light to promote hair follicles. This non-invasive treatment promotes hair growth by boosting mobile activity and boosting blood flow in the scalp.
When you undergo this treatment, you'll see that the low-level laser light permeates the skin, energizing the hair roots and motivating them to get in the development stage of the hair cycle.
You could question how this process works. The light produced throughout the therapy activates the mitochondria within your cells, boosting energy production and promoting the recovery process. Therefore, your follicles can recuperate from any type of damage, bring about much healthier hair growth.
This therapy is typically painless and requires no downtime, making it a convenient choice for lots of individuals looking for hair reconstruction.

Factors Affecting Treatment Frequency
The efficiency of cold laser treatment for hair remediation can be substantially influenced by several variables, especially the frequency of treatments.
First, consider your hair loss stage. If you're in the beginning, you might need more frequent sessions to stimulate hair follicles successfully. On the other hand, if your loss of hair is advanced, a different approach may be required.
Next off, think about the underlying causes of your loss of hair. Problems like hormonal imbalances or dietary shortages can impact how your body responds to therapy. If these troubles aren't attended to, you might not see the desired outcomes, despite treatment regularity.

Age can also be an element; older people may experience slower hair development, necessitating even more constant sessions.
Lastly, the details cold laser device utilized can influence therapy frequency. Some tools may call for more constant usage to accomplish ideal results, while others may be more reliable with less frequent applications.
Recommended Treatment Routines
When intending your therapy timetable for hair remediation, uniformity is crucial to achieving optimal outcomes. A lot of professionals advise starting with three sessions weekly for the very first month. This regular therapy aids start the hair repair process by stimulating hair follicles and promoting circulation in the scalp.
As you progress, you can progressively decrease the frequency to 2 sessions weekly for the complying with 2 to 3 months. This change allows your scalp to proceed gaining from the therapy while providing you some flexibility in your routine.
Hereafter initial period, many discover that once-a-week sessions can keep the outcomes you've accomplished, particularly if you're integrating cold laser therapy with other hair restoration methods.
Always listen to your body; if you really feel any type of pain or do not see outcomes, consult your healthcare provider for individualized recommendations. Tracking your progress can additionally assist you identify if changes to your timetable are needed.
